- The name is derived from the word "ugly" refering to the it's unpleasant appearance, with rough, wrinkled, greenish-yellow rind, wrapped loosely around the orange pulpy citrus inside.
- Cloudberry is also called as bakeapple, knotberry , knoutberry, aqpik or low bush salmonberry.
- In Nordic countries, cloudberries are used to make traditional liqueurs.

The amount of calories in 100 gm of fresh Ugli fruit and Cloudberry with peel is 45.00 kcal and 51.00 kcal and the amount of calories without peel is 43.00 kcal and 47.00 kcal respectively. Thus, Ugli fruit and Cloudberry belong to Low Calorie Fruits and Low Calorie Fruits category.These fruits might or might not differ with respect to their scientific classification. The order of Ugli fruit and Cloudberry is Sapindales and Rosales respectively. Ugli fruit belongs to Rutaceae family and Cloudberry belongs to Rosaceae family. Ugli fruit belongs to Citrus genus of C. reticulata × paradisi species and Cloudberry belongs to Rubus genus of R. chamaemorus species. Beings plants, both fruits belong to Plantae Kingdom.
